Understanding Comprehensive Coverage

Comprehensive coverage isn’t just a fancy term thrown around by insurance agents; it’s that safety net designed to protect your vehicle from a variety of unforeseen incidents—think of it as your all-around, go-to insurance weapon. Unlike Liability or Collision coverage, which are tailored for specific scenarios—like accidents with other drivers or objects—Comprehensive coverage takes care of events that are often beyond your control.

When you hit an animal—let's say a deer, which is unfortunately common in Pennsylvania—you perceive it as a collision. But technically, it’s categorized under Comprehensive coverage because it’s an animal, not another vehicle. This distinctive feature is crucial to comprehend if you want to safeguard your wallet from those likely hefty repair bills.

What’s the Difference? Liability vs. Collision vs. Comprehensive

To make sense of all the jargon, let’s take a quick pit stop at different types of car insurance.

  • Liability Coverage: This is mandatory in most states, including Pennsylvania. It essentially covers damages to other parties when you’re technically at fault in an accident. Think of it as your promise to be a responsible driver; it helps cover other people's expenses, but will not aid you or your vehicle.

  • Collision Coverage: This kicks in if you hit another vehicle or property—say, you back into a mailbox. This coverage can be a lifesaver, but it specifically excludes animal strikes.

  • Comprehensive Coverage: As we discussed, this looks after a myriad of external accidents that don’t involve direct collisions with a vehicle. It’s your shield against those unexpected and wild moments!
